Someone asked me why is this my profile picture, and the answer stunned them so they suggest I make it into a discussion.
My profile picture is not me,obviously...but it does say a lot about me. I find myself being artistic, with almost everything in my surroundings. I relate to life as if it were a painting, a poem, a novel, or even a drawing. I see beauty in everything, but often other people see ugliness and negativity.
My profile picture is not of myself because I am not a product, I do not want people to see me when they read my stories, poems, or journal entries...I want them to see a mystery, find a meaning of their own and turn into something they can use as inspiration. There is always more than meets the eyes, I do not want to limit myself or others by what they see when they see me.
Some of my discussions are short conversations, others are a deeper side that most people never see. The better part of me lives through these pages. Notebooks, discussions, poetry websites, something that adds meaning...I do this with just a pencil and a piece of blank paper.
I always hoped to inspire people, even if it is just one person my dream will have come true.
I have been working on a journal discussion about what we're leaving behind when our time is up...I want my stories to be known, to leave a mark on the world so even after I am gone, someone going through a hard time will come across it and KNOW that they are not alone in what they are feeling because there are millions in the world feeling the same exact thing.
Shallow first impressions, I have always hated those...I have never wanted people to know me by my face, but who I am as a soul...
That is why this is my profile picture.
